Additional information
A novel approach for controlling the operation of a hydrocyclone was introduced. The central part of this research was the finite element software package developed by Nowakowski, which enabled investigation of the influence of the hydrocyclone geometry upon flow character. Other colleagues working on hydrocyclones have subsequently used the code and currently this research continues together with DuPont (contact: Area Manager Research)
